Stephen Hawking warns against 'replying to alien signals'

If aliens visit us, the outcome could be like when Columbus landed in America, which didn't turn out well for the Native Americans, he said.

Physicist Stephen Hawking has warned his fellow Earth mates to be cautious about sending back signals in response to aliens.

In an online show, named ‘Stephen Hawking’s Favourite Places’, Stephen Hawking revealed his fears over extraterrestrial civilization who may conquer Earth.

In the online show, the renowned astrophysicist takes viewers on his CGI spacecraft to about five relevant locations across the cosmos. During the tour he mentioned that a planet like Gliese 832c, located approximately 16 light-year away from Earth, could one day possibly send signals to our planet, however “we should be wary of replying” to them.

Even “if aliens visit us, the outcome could be much like when Columbus landed in America, which didn’t turn out well for the Native Americans,” Professor Hawking said.

“Such advanced aliens would perhaps become nomads, looking to conquer and colonize whatever planets they can reach,” he added.
